    • @nathansomething4634
      @nathansomething4634 4 ปีที่แล้ว +21

      You get significant price breaks when buying tons and tons of one design versus 1/3 of three designs, etc. This is called a price break; the more you order of one thing, the cheaper they give each one for. This is because they only have to configure their factory once to make the thing and can just let it run until the order is done, rather than shutting down, reconfiguring, and starting it back up. All of that stuff in between takes time, and factory time is money.
      The manufacturer will also have an MOQ, or Minimum Order Quantity. For big custom items like this case, they may have to order 10,000+ just to get the manufacturer to make any at all. To get around this, they'd just have the needed blanking/adapter plates made somewhere else (extremely cheap) and assemble.

    • @ianweber9248
      @ianweber9248 4 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      Lagged2Death It’s called thin Mini ITX and, while I’m not sure if it was ever an “official” standard, enough companies made enough hardware (Asus has listings for thin mini itx mobos as recent as the H310 chipset) around it for it to be standard enough. I can’t say I’ve seen/heard of any with standard DIMM slots though, most of the ones I’m familiar with use SODIMMs since they mount flat against the board lowering the height (think PCs built into cases similar in size to standalone DVD players) of the overall system even further.

  • @helloimash
    @helloimash 4 ปีที่แล้ว +1

    I'd like to try to explain why a computer company does this. In the world of office PCs, your margins and profit are absolutely key. It makes *a lot* more sense if you can produce one PC case that you can use all up and down various price categories, because your margins are much higher on one very flexible PC case vs. the whole design process of several unique cases. In this case, the hardware is likely the cheapest possible configuration available - suitable (for example) sitting under a receptionist or secretary's desk, whose IT needs are extremely basic and so the company wants to buy something as cheap as possible. For this use case, the company selling this makes the best profit because all that's really unique to this PC is the internal guts. Everything else is reused from what they already have and so their profit on each of these sold is good. Hope this is helpful, genuinely.
